The correct answer is B. Transport Layer. Data segmentation is a Transport Layer function. At Layer 4, protocols such as TCP divide application data into smaller pieces called segments so that data can be transported between endpoints. The Transport Layer also uses TCP and UDP port numbers to identify application conversations between hosts. HPE Aruba Networking AOS-CX ACL documentation references TCP/UDP ports as Layer 4 ports, which aligns transport-layer port usage with the Transport Layer. The Application Layer provides user-facing application services, but it does not perform transport segmentation. The Network Layer handles logical IP addressing and routing. The Data Link Layer handles Ethernet framing, MAC addressing, and local delivery on a network segment. Therefore, when the question asks where data segmentation occurs in the OSI model, the correct answer is the Transport Layer. ( arubanetworking.hpe.com )
